Understanding UPVC Door Mechanisms
UPVC doors normally include a multi-point locking system, ensuring enhanced security. The mechanism is made up of different parts, each serving a particular function. Below is a breakdown of the main components discovered in most Upvc Door Mechanism Repair door locks.
ElementFunctionCylinderEnables the key to engage the locking mechanismGearboxConverts the key's rotation into locking actionMulti-Point LockingEngages numerous deadbolts into the door framePinsProtect the door in a locked positionManagesRun the locking and opening mechanismCommon Issues with UPVC Door Mechanisms
UPVC Door Maintenance door systems can experience various issues over time, affecting their functionality. Understanding these issues is the primary step in addressing them effectively.
1. Trouble in Locking or Unlocking
Among the most common problems house owners deal with is the door being difficult to lock or unlock. This might be due to misalignment or wear and tear on the locking mechanism.
2. Loose Handles
If the door handles feel floppy or loose, it can impede the locking mechanism, leading to possible security concerns.
3. Sticking Doors
Doors that stick open or closed are often out of alignment, which can be an outcome of shifting foundations or modifications in temperature and humidity.
4. Irregular Lock Engagement
In some cases, the lock may engage randomly or not at all, which can stem from broken pins or concerns in the gearbox.
5. Sound During Operation
If you hear grinding or scraping noises when operating the door, it could suggest that gears are harmed or not lubricated correctly.
Tools Required for UPVC Door Mechanism Repair
Before beginning any repair work, it's necessary to collect the needed tools. Here's a list of tools that might be required:
ToolPurposeScrewdriverTo get rid of screws and access the mechanismLube (e.g. WD-40)To oil moving partsAllen keysFor tightening up handles or particular partsPliersTo grip and control little componentsReplacement partsAs needed, such as multi-point locks or cylindersStep-by-Step Repair Guide
Although some problems might require professional help, numerous problems can be quickly fixed by following these actions:
Step 1: Identify the ProblemCheck if the door is misaligned: Close the door and see if it fits comfortably in the frame.Observe the deals with for looseness or play.Try to lock and open the door to assess how quickly the mechanism engages.Step 2: Tighten Loose HandlesUtilize the screwdriver to access the screws on the handle.Tighten up the screws gently to prevent stripping them, ensuring they are safe and secure however not overly tight.Action 3: Align the DoorIf the door is sticking, it might require realignment. This can include adjusting the hinges. Loosen the screws, rearrange the door, and retighten them.Step 4: Lubricate the MechanismApply a lubricant to the cylinder, equipments, and pins. This can alleviate sticking and enhance the general functionality.Step 5: Replace Damaged PartsIf particular parts are broken, such as the transmission or the cylinder, they need to be replaced. Unscrew the broken part, and set up the new one following the maker's guidelines.Step 6: Test the MechanismAfter making repairs, test the door multiple times to ensure smooth operation. It should lock and unlock easily.Maintenance Tips to Prevent Future Issues
Routine maintenance of UPVC doors can assist prevent typical problems in the future. Here are some ideas:
Regular Lubrication: Lubricate the moving parts a minimum of twice a year utilizing a silicone-based lube.Keep the Door Clean: Regularly clean the door and frame to prevent dirt accumulation, which can block the locking mechanism.Check Weather Stripping: Check the weather removing for wear and replace it if it's harmed, preventing drafts and possible warping.Tighten Screws: Periodically inspect and tighten up screws on handles, hinges, and locks to guarantee they stay safe.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)1. How frequently should I oil my UPVC door locks?It is recommended to oil your UPVC door locks at least two times a year.2. What should I do if my UPVC door will not lock?Initially, check for misalignment or blockages in the locking mechanism. If the issue continues, think about consulting a professional locksmith.3. Can I change a harmed locking mechanism myself?Yes, numerous property owners can change a harmed locking mechanism with the right tools and instructions. However, if you are not sure, it is a good idea to look for professional help.4. What kind of lubricant is best for UPVC doors?A silicone-based lubricant or a dry lubricant is preferred as these will not bring in dirt and will guarantee smooth operation.5. Is it necessary to employ a professional for all UPVC door repairs?Not all repairs need professional intervention. Fundamental concerns like tightening up deals with or lubricating systems can typically be handled in the house. However, for elaborate problems or replacements, a professional may be best.
